<h2>IV. Service Content</h2>
|
|
<p><span class="bold">4.1 Service Overview:</span> Relying on artificial intelligence technology, the Service
|
|
provides intelligent interaction services for connected hardware devices through API calls to third-party
|
|
generative AI models, including but not limited to Voice Activity Detection (VAD), Automatic Speech Recognition
|
|
(ASR), Large Language Model (LLM), Text-to-Speech (TTS), Vision Large Language Model (VLLM), Intent Recognition,
|
|
Conversation Memory, and Retrieval-Augmented Generation (RAG).
|
|
</p>
|
|
<p><span class="bold">4.2 Agent Management:</span> You can create and configure Agents through the Admin Console,
|
|
including setting role templates, selecting language models, configuring voice parameters, setting intent
|
|
recognition rules, managing knowledge bases, enabling conversation memory, configuring Agent plugins, etc. The
|
|
Agent settings shall not violate national laws and regulations.</p>
|
|
<p><span class="bold">4.3 Device Management:</span> You can bind and manage your hardware devices through the Admin
|
|
Console, perform device configuration, firmware updates, OTA remote upgrades, etc. You shall ensure that the
|
|
devices you manage are lawfully owned or authorized by you.</p>
|
|
<p><span class="bold">4.4 Visual Understanding:</span> The Service supports image capture through device cameras and
|
|
uses third-party vision models for image recognition and scene understanding. You shall ensure that image
|
|
capture complies with relevant laws and regulations and does not infringe upon others' privacy.</p>
|
|
<p><span class="bold">4.5 Intent Recognition:</span> The Service can understand the intent of user commands through
|
|
intent recognition and trigger corresponding operations or services, such as controlling smart devices, querying
|
|
information, etc.</p>
|
|
<p><span class="bold">4.6 Conversation Memory:</span> The Service can record and store summaries of your interaction
|
|
history with the Agent to provide more coherent and personalized interaction experiences in subsequent
|
|
conversations. You can manage or clear memory data in the Admin Console.</p>
|
|
<p><span class="bold">4.7 Knowledge Base:</span> The Service supports uploading documents, texts, and other content
|
|
to build knowledge bases. Agents can retrieve knowledge base content during conversations to provide Q&A
|
|
services. You shall ensure that uploaded knowledge base content does not infringe upon third-party intellectual
|
|
property rights and does not contain content that violates laws and regulations.</p>
|
|
<p><span class="bold">4.8 Voice Print Recognition:</span> The Service supports voice print recognition. You can
|
|
register voice print samples to achieve speaker identity verification and personalized services. Voice print
|
|
data will be used for identity verification purposes.</p>
|
|
<p><span class="bold">4.9 Voice Cloning:</span> The Service supports voice cloning. You can clone custom voice
|
|
timbres by providing audio samples. Cloned voices are for your personal use only and shall not be used to
|
|
impersonate others or engage in illegal activities.</p>
|
|
<p><span class="bold">4.10 MCP Endpoints:</span> The Service supports MCP (Model Context Protocol) and can serve as
|
|
an MCP Server to provide tool calling capabilities to external systems, or as an MCP Client to call external MCP
|
|
services, achieving standardized integration with external systems.</p>
|
|
<p><span class="bold">4.11 Context Providers:</span> the Service supports Context Provider functionality, which can
|
|
obtain real-time information from external data sources, such as weather, news, stocks, etc., providing Agents
|
|
with richer knowledge sources.</p>
|
|
<p><span class="bold">4.12 MQTT Protocol:</span> The Service supports MQTT (Message Queuing Telemetry Transport)
|
|
protocol for message communication between IoT devices. You can use the MQTT protocol to send device control
|
|
commands, monitor device status, etc.</p>
|
|
<p><span class="bold">4.13 Service Disclaimer:</span> The conversations and responses generated by third-party AI
|
|
models that the Service depends on are for reference only and do not constitute professional advice in any
|
|
field. You shall not use the output content as professional advice in medical, legal, financial, or other
|
|
professional fields. Any judgments or decisions you make based on the output content shall be entirely at your
|
|
own responsibility.</p>

<p class="bold">4.14 Service Fees: The Service is a free open-source project and does not charge any usage fees from
|
|
users. It only provides platform capabilities for calling third-party services and does not involve any paid
|
|
functions or value-added services.</p>
|
|
<p>The Service supports multiple AI service providers with different billing models as follows:</p>
|
|
<p>(1) <span class="bold">Free Services:</span> Some service providers offer free quotas or completely free
|
|
services, such as Zhipu AI (free models like glm-4-flash), Microsoft EdgeTTS voice synthesis, etc.</p>
|
|
<p>(2) <span class="bold">Pay-as-you-go:</span> Some service providers charge based on API usage, such as OpenAI,
|
|
Alibaba Cloud Intelligent Speech, Baidu Wenxin, iFlytek, etc. You need to pay the corresponding fees to
|
|
third-party service providers yourself. Such fees are unrelated to this Service.</p>
|
|
<p>(3) <span class="bold">Local Deployment:</span> The Service supports fully local AI deployment solutions, such as
|
|
FunASR speech recognition, FishSpeech voice synthesis, Ollama local large models, etc. Local deployment does not
|
|
require network fees or API usage fees but requires sufficient local computing resources.</p>
|
|
<p>You can choose a suitable service provider based on your actual needs and budget. For specific fee standards,
|
|
please refer to the official documentation of each service provider.</p>
